Agilitas appoints Gary Lomas as Chief Revenue Officer

Agilitas IT Solutions has appointed Gary Lomas as Chief Revenue Officer. This marks the first announcement of executive appointments from Agilitas as it looks to embark on the next phase of its growth strategy.

Commencing his role later this month, Gary will be responsible for driving business success across the entire revenue cycle, strengthening Agilitas’ business resilience, whilst helping to deliver optimal outcomes within the diverse Technology Channel.

With over 30 years of experience, Gary joins Agilitas from Cisilion, where as Head of Enterprise Sales, he was responsible for leading their Enterprise sales team, developing sales strategy, driving deeper engagement into Cisilion’s largest clients and securing new Enterprise logos. Gary previously held Sales Director positions at Ingram Micro and at Logicalis where he successfully delivered significant Service focused change programs, and more recently as Sales Director at Onnec, delivering against key business objectives and opening up new avenues with complimentary IT services.

Speaking on his new role, Gary Lomas said, “I’m joining Agilitas at an exciting and crucial time in its growth strategy, as the business looks to build upon its solid foundations in delivering superior customer success strategies. I’m looking forward to utilising my experience in developing trust-based, long-standing relationships with customers, vendors and partners, as well as identifying strategic partnerships, to help drive Agilitas’ profitability and success.

“I am driven to make a positive impact on future results and want Agilitas to be seen as a respected thought leader services partner who listens to its partners and their customers, enabling us to build relevant services for the channel. I’m excited to connect with our existing and potential Channel Partners and vendors in the coming weeks.”

“We are all delighted to welcome Gary as our new Chief Revenue Officer. With a respected career in the Technology Channel, he brings the relevant knowledge needed to become the driving force in maximising Agilitas’ revenue streams. Gary's ability to recognise trends before others in the market, combined with his leadership skills and passion for technology, will enable us to make bold business decisions,” added Sara Wilkes, Chief Operating Officer at Agilitas.

Mark Blower, Partner at Perwyn, Agilitas’ Private Equity Investor concluded, “Gary’s appointment at Agilitas signals the next stage in the business’ growth strategy. Bringing extensive expertise in strategic planning and operational execution, Gary will be a valuable asset to Agilitas in helping to meet and exceed customers’ expectations across the broad technology sector which is currently full of ambiguity and change.”
